Output ec1c8d722969e6433f0d6b85203b11489bcf3ac2a583ceb0142e873bb7518b6e:1

value
678958
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 bd1ecbd97cc3d4afbe9e6bde99943aaf2e6868fc OP_EQUALVERIFY OP_CHECKSIG
address
1JEyc28cxc81nZ48EwdoCWwPAm8BEsnnTp
transaction
ec1c8d722969e6433f0d6b85203b11489bcf3ac2a583ceb0142e873bb7518b6e
spent
true